Synchronous Condenser

An over-excited synchronous motor running on no-load is called the synchronous condenser.

 It is also known as synchronous capacitor or synchronous compensator or synchronous phase modifier.

What is a Synchronous Condenser

A synchronous motor can deliver or absorb reactive power by changing the DC excitation of its field winding.

It can be made to draw a leading current from the supply with over-excitation of its field winding and therefore, it supplies lagging reactive power (or absorbs leading reactive power).
